Why Fabric Waste Starts During the Sampling Phase
Sampling remains one of the largest hidden sources of waste in the fashion industry. Many garments go through several prototype stages before approval, with each version requiring additional fabric, transportation, packaging, and labor.
Distributed teams can unintentionally make the problem worse. A designer in London may request changes from a manufacturer in Vietnam while merchandising teams in New York review updates several days later. That lag often creates duplicate samples, outdated revisions, and miscommunication around specifications.
Remote design streaming changes the pace of that process. Teams can review garments live through high-resolution video systems, annotate changes immediately, and approve adjustments without waiting for additional shipments. Faster communication reduces unnecessary iterations and allows brands to catch issues before fabric is cut at scale.

Digital Fashion Workflows Are Becoming More Practical
Fashion technology once centered around experimental virtual runways and speculative digital clothing concepts. Today, the focus is shifting toward practical workflow improvements that reduce operational costs and material waste.
Brands increasingly use:
3D garment visualization
Live remote fitting reviews
Shared cloud-based asset libraries
Real-time pattern editing
Digital fabric simulations
Remote production monitoring
These systems allow teams to test adjustments digitally before creating physical versions. Designers can compare drape, structure, and silhouette changes without immediately producing another sample.

Streaming Reviews Can Reduce Overproduction Risks
One overlooked advantage of remote design streaming is faster alignment between departments. Design teams, buyers, merchandisers, and production managers can all review updates simultaneously instead of working through disconnected approval chains.
That visibility helps brands make better forecasting decisions earlier in development. If a product requires repeated redesigns or presents manufacturing issues, teams can identify problems before large production orders are placed.
Overproduction remains one of fashion’s most persistent waste issues. Unsold inventory frequently ends up discounted, destroyed, or abandoned in storage. Improving communication during development may not eliminate overproduction, but it helps brands avoid committing resources to flawed designs.
Remote systems also create more detailed digital records of revisions and approvals. Teams can reference previous discussions quickly instead of recreating work or misunderstanding earlier feedback.
